Let’s be honest—working out at home sounds amazing in theory. You’ve got the space, the time, and the perfect playlist ready to motivate you into full beast mode. But somehow, despite all that prep, things never quite go as planned. Here are five things you can 100% expect to happen during your home workout, no matter how organized you think you are:

1. Your Pet Will Become Your Personal Trainer

Is there a rule that says the moment you hit play on your workout video, your dog/cat/ferret must immediately join in? No? Well, someone should tell them because they’ll be right there.

Whether it’s a yoga flow or a high-intensity cardio session, your pet will either:

  • A) Sit right under your feet, causing you to tiptoe through squats like a ninja.
  • B) Decide that your yoga mat is actually their mat.
  • C) Insist on being part of your resistance band workout. You didn’t need that band unchewed, did you?

2. You’ll Find Yourself Staring Into The Void

That 30-second plank is plenty of time for self-reflection, right? Suddenly, you’re not thinking about your core anymore. Nope. Instead, you’re wondering:

  • Did I leave the oven on?
  • What’s my childhood friend from second grade doing right now?
  • Will my arms ever stop shaking?

Before you know it, you’re in an existential crisis—while still holding the plank because gains, right?

3. Your Family Will Suddenly Need You

You could sit silently for hours, and no one will ask for anything. But the minute you hit that sweet burpee rhythm? BOOM. You’re the most in-demand person in the house.

Your kids, spouse, or roommates will immediately find pressing concerns that only you can resolve, like:

  • “Where’s the ketchup?”
  • “Can you help me with this math problem?”
  • “The Wi-Fi stopped working!”

I mean, how dare you try to squat in peace when ketchup is MIA?

4. The Perfect Workout Outfit Will Betray You

We all know that looking cute in your workout gear equals 20% more motivation. That is, until your leggings start rolling down mid-jumping jack, or your sports bra decides it’s taking the day off. Nothing says “focus” like constantly hiking up your waistband while trying to deadlift.

Bonus points if you go for a quick mirror check and realize you’ve been wearing your top inside out the whole time. Winning.

5. You’ll Feel Like a Hero Afterward (Even If You Only Half Tried)

Here’s the thing: No matter how many interruptions, questionable planks, or wardrobe malfunctions you experience, the end result is always the same—you feel like a superhero afterward.

Yes, you may have spent half the workout getting your dog off your mat, and yes, your squats may have been cut short by a ketchup crisis, but you showed up, and that’s what matters! Cue the Rocky theme song.

At the end of the day, working out at home isn’t about perfection. It’s about staying sane, moving your body, and laughing through the chaos (while occasionally dodging a furry friend). So, the next time your workout takes a turn for the weird, just remember: You’re not alone, and you’re still crushing it!
